Job Description

An opportunity to join a leading housing provider to work within its industry leading Building Safety team as a Contract Delivery Surveyor. This key role supports the delivery of high-quality contracted Lift / LOLER related maintenance services, ensuring that contracted works are delivered in-line with current regulation and legislation.

Working closely with the wider team and contractors, you'll ensure that challenging operational objectives and KPIs are achieved in a legislatively compliant, timely, cost effective and customer focused manner at all times. On a daily basis you'll demonstrate a dedication to achieving compliance performance and achieving targets for respective contracts which are being delivered; relishing the opportunity to gain value for money whilst ensuring customers are provided with a seamless high-quality service.

  • An outline of your experience and expertise in building safety, ideally with a background in lift compliance / LOLER.
  • Experience of financial reporting and administration checking invoices, raising purchase orders, scrutinising payments, reviewing valuations etc.
  • Experience of ensuring compliance against programmed works delivery.
  • Experience or knowledge of working with a housing provider.
